India Beat Pakistan by 5 Wickets in Asia Cup Final 2025

The Asia Cup Final 2025 was held on September 28, 2025, at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ium. It was a high-pressure clash between arch-rivals India and Pakistan. India won the toss, opted to bowl first, and successfully chased the target with 5 wickets in hand, becoming the new Asia Cup champions.

Asia Cup Final 2025

Pakistan Innings: 146 All Out (19.1 Overs)

Pakistan struggled against India’s disciplined bowling attack and were bowled out for 146 runs.

Top Scorers:

  • Fakhar Zaman – 46 (32 balls, 2 fours, 3 sixes)
  • Sahibzada Farhan – 57 (38 balls, 5 fours, 3 sixes)

Key Bowling for India:

  • Kuldeep Yadav: 4/30 (4 overs)
  • Varun Chakaravarthy: 2/30 (4 overs)
  • Jasprit Bumrah: 2/25 (3.1 overs)

Fall of Wickets: Pakistan lost wickets at regular intervals. From 113/2 in the 13th over, they collapsed to 146 all out in 19.1 overs.

India Innings: 150/5 (19.4 Overs)

India’s chase began nervously, losing three wickets inside the first four overs. However, a solid middle-order performance guided the team to victory.

Top Scorers:

  • Tilak Varma: 69* (53 balls, 3 fours, 4 sixes)
  • Sanju Samson: 24 (21 balls, 2 fours, 1 six)
  • Shivam Dube: 33 (22 balls, 2 fours, 2 sixes)

Pakistan’s Key Bowlers:

  • Faheem Ashraf: 3/29 (4 overs)
  • Shaheen Afridi: 1/20 (4 overs)

Match-winning Moment: Tilak Varma’s unbeaten knock and Rinku Singh’s calm finish helped India cross the target with 2 balls to spare.

Key Turning Points

  1. Pakistan Collapse: From 113/2, they lost 8 wickets for just 33 runs.
  2. Kuldeep’s Magic: His 4 wickets broke Pakistan’s backbone in the middle overs.
  3. Tilak Varma’s Knock: A composed 69* under pressure anchored India’s chase.

Match Result

  • Winner: India by 5 wickets
  • Venue: Dubai International Cricket Stadium, Dubai
  • Date: September 28, 2025
